How Our Crawl Space Water Extraction Process Works

Our team’s process for crawl space water extraction is designed to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. We know that water damage can be a stressful and overwhelming experience, which is why we’re committed to making the process as smooth and hassle-free as possible. From initial assessment to final cleanup, we’ll be with you every step of the way.

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our technicians will arrive at your home to assess the extent of the damage and find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the water and create a customized plan to extract it.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our state-of-the-art equipment, we’ll extract the water from your crawl space, working quickly and efficiently to reduce further damage. We’ll also use specialized dr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your crawl space, ensuring that it’s completely free of moisture and ready for repairs. We’ll also ap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and mildew growth.

Step 4: Cleanup and Repairs

Finally, we’ll clean up any debris or mess left behind and make any necessary repairs to your crawl space, including replacing any damaged insulation or structural elements. We’ll also provide you with a thorough inspection report to ensure that your home is safe and secure.

Crawl Space Water Extraction Cost In Gainesville, TX

The cost of crawl space water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the Gainesville area. These are estimated price ranges, not guarantees.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Inspection $100 – $500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ment required
Dehumidification and Ventilation $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of humidity
Repairs and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required
Antimicrobial Treatments and Cleaning $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the level of contamination
Final Inspection and Report $100 – $500 The extent of the damage and the level of detail required

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ation. We offer free estimates and consultations to ensure you get the best possible service at a price that fits your budget.

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Extraction

How Long Does Crawl Space Water Extraction Take?

The length of time required for crawl space water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, our teams can complete the job within 3-5 days.

Is Crawl Space Water Extraction Covered by Insurance?

Yes, crawl space water extraction is typically cov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and the circumstances of the damage.

Can I Prevent Crawl Space Water Damage?

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ent crawl space water damage, including regular inspections, proper ventilation, and fixing any leaks or cracks in the crawl space. Regular maintenance can help prevent costly repairs down the line.
